Case evaluation

Cerebral palsy is a permanent impairment caused by brain damage or abnormal development. It can hinder the ability of a person to control their muscles, and can cause other impairments, like development delays or skeletal issues. It may cause hearing loss, vision impairments, cerebral palsy lawsuit or other impairments. The condition can result from a variety of factors such as a deficiency of oxygen during pregnancy or the birth, premature birth, blood disorders associated with jaundice, infections in the mother, and mechanical trauma.

The process of filing a cerebrospinal palsy lawsuit begins with an initial consultation. During this no-cost and no-obligation consultation attorneys for cerebral palsy will establish the value of your case and determine if you have a valid claim. The cerebral palsy lawyers will then file the lawsuit on your behalf as the plaintiff. The medical professional or hospital believed to be the cause will then be given a specific period of time to provide an answer. Both teams will collect evidence, such as written documents and expert testimony, to negotiate a settlement without having to go to court. A third-party mediator is often brought in to help with mediation.
